Florida executed Loran Cole by lethal injection Thursday in the 1994 murder of 18-year-old John Edwards and the rape of his sister in Marion County.
Cole was convicted of first-degree murder in the Feb. 18, 1994, killing of Florida State University freshman John Edwards, as well as sexual assault for raping Edward's 21-year-old sister at the time.
